    Bookings open for 2020 Triumph Street Triple R

    Share

    Selected Triumph dealers in India have started accepting bookings for the upcoming 2020 Triumph Street Triple R. Triumph’s multiple award-winning Street Triple R is updated with an aggressive new attitude and style, and a more responsive Euro 5 compliant high-performance 765cc engine. The Street Triple R will be the most affordable naked/street-fighter motorcycle in Triumph’s Indian line up.

    The new Triumph Street Triple R features all new bodywork, including fly screen, air intake, side panels and rear unit. These are more angular and sporty, giving the motorcycle cleaner, more contemporary lines, and a distinctive new look. The fly screen and air intake are now much more pronounced, echoing the shape of the new twin LED headlights, which have a striking new style with prominent position lights, giving a much more distinctive front end and increased visibility.

    The Triumph Street Triple R is powered by a high-performance 765cc engine which churns out peak power of 118PS at 12,000rpm, and exhilarating peak torque of 77Nm at 9,400rpm. Just like the top spec RS model, the Street Triple R has a smooth gearbox with short first and second gear ratios, delivering exceptional acceleration performance and slick gear changes. It also features a slip and assist clutch, which reduces clutch lever effort and improves rider comfort and control.

    In terms of technology, the Street Triple R comes with the Triumph Shift Assist up, down quickshifter, ride-by-wire, ABS and traction control as standard feature. The Triumph Shift Assist enables smooth, comfortable and quick gear changes without the use of the clutch, whilst maintaining the accelerator position. There are also three riding modes for maximum control in all conditions – Road, Rain and Sport. These adjust throttle response and traction control settings and are easily selectable while riding via the Street Triple R’s LCD instruments. Rain mode restricts peak power to 100PS for better feel and a smoother ride.

    The new Street Triple R can be customised with a range of over 60 genuine accessories, including contemporary new scrolling LED indicators, a new fly screen visor, and new machined mirrors and reservoirs. Plus there’s a new range of stylish water resistant luggage with quick release mounting, including a tank bag and tail pack. There’s also an Arrow silencer and adjustable brake and clutch levers, making the Street Triple R ready for even the most focused road riding. For added comfort, there are internally wired multi-setting heated grips, while for additional style and detailing, there’s a tail tidy, new colour coordinated belly pan and seat cowl, and a clear rear light assembly.

    The new Triumph Street Triple R will cost slightly more than the old Street Triple S which was priced at Rs 9.2 lakh. We expect it to be priced around the Rs 9.5 lakh (ex.showroom). The 2020 Triumph Street Triple R will compete with the likes of the newly launched BMW F 900 R, upcoming BS6 KTM 790 Duke and upcoming BS6-compliant Ducati Monster 821.
